最佳答案从源代码编译安装ivreghdfe工具 如果你是一位数据分析师或开发工程师,你经常需要处理大量的数据。并且你可能听说过ivreghdfe,这是一个用于估计具有异质性的面板数据的Python...
从源代码编译安装ivreghdfe工具
如果你是一位数据分析师或开发工程师,你经常需要处理大量的数据。并且你可能听说过ivreghdfe,这是一个用于估计具有异质性的面板数据的Python软件包。为了获得最佳性能和特定于自己的需求的配置,你需要从源代码编译安装该工具。本文将为您提供安装ivreghdfe的详细指南。
步骤1:安装编译依赖项
在编译安装任何软件包之前,必须先安装其依赖项。在Ubuntu系统上,你可以使用以下命令安装编译ivreghdfe所需的依赖项:
sudo apt-get install python3-dev gfortran libopenblas-dev liblapack-dev
步骤2:下载和解压缩源代码
现在,你需要下载并解压缩ivreghdfe源代码。你可以从官方的Github仓库中下载该源代码,或者你也可以使用以下命令来下载:
git clone https://github.com/rsquaredacademy/ivreghdfe.git
完成下载后,进入项目目录并解压缩源代码:
cd ivreghdfe
unzip ivreghdfe-master.zip
步骤3:编译和安装ivreghdfe
使用以下命令编译和安装ivreghdfe:
cd ivreghdfe-master
sudo python3 setup.py install
如果你想在安装过程中查看更详细的信息,可以使用以下命令:
sudo python3 setup.py build_ext --inplace -j <number of cores>
这将在当前文件夹中生成一个名为ivreghdfe.so的文件。这个文件是ivreghdfe的Python扩展模块。
总结
恭喜!你已经成功地从源代码编译安装了ivreghdfe工具。虽然这并不是最简单的安装方式,但它确实为您提供了更多的配置选项和更好的性能。请按照本文提供的步骤进行操作,如果您遇到任何错误或困难,请查看项目文档或寻求开发社区的帮助。